Description_x000D_ Application_x000D_ RPMI 1640 Medium was developed at Roswell Park Memorial Institute in 1966 by Moore and his co-workers. A modification of McCoy′s 5A Medium, it was formulated to support lymphoblastoid cells in suspension culture, but it has since been shown to support a wide variety of cells that are anchorage dependent. Originally intended to be used with a serum supplement, RPMI 1640 has been shown to support several cell lines in the absence of serum. It has also been widely used in fusion protocols and in the growth of hybrid cells._x000D_ Other Notes_x000D_ Modified for autoclaving_x000D_ Without L-glutamine and sodium bicarbonate._x000D_ Quantity_x000D_ Formulated to contain 10.3 grams of powder per liter of medium._x000D_ Reconstitution_x000D_ Supplement with 0.3 L-glutamine, 2.0 g/L sodium bicarbonate._x000D_ Legal Information_x000D_ Auto-Mod is a trademark of Sigma-Aldrich Co.
